Output 2aeb3d8226a588f5d95d67651165c8026ac70a386e2154bae42e11d1684feeeb:0

value
2592153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bd75067e493a21d766eea4f92de8078aac7c17c OP_EQUAL
address
32mdHwQPnmwGHgQUD2tcoxzTeHmq8BpTjd
transaction
2aeb3d8226a588f5d95d67651165c8026ac70a386e2154bae42e11d1684feeeb
confirmations
264598
spent
true